Executive Assistant-Spyder
Specific Responsibilities
• Manage the Executive's calendars and appointments
• Schedule and organize meetings, travel arrangements, conferences, etc.
• Conduct research to identify most appropriate locations and pricing and manage all details pertaining to reservations and itineraries
• Coordinate and plan luncheons and other events
• Prepare agendas, distribute information or invitations and may assist with set-up of the facilities
• Organizing, preparing, and prioritizing correspondence
• Answer telephone calls for Executive
• Take messages and respond to calls in a timely manner
• Take and transcribe dictation, and compose and prepare confidential correspondence, memos, business plans, etc.
• Proofread copy for spelling, grammar, and layout and makes appropriate changes
• Responsible for accuracy and clarity of final copy
• Open and distribute mail and determine level of priority
• Respond to routine mail and e-mail for Executives and other external correspondence when necessary
• Prepare and modify visual presentations
• Perform various administrative/clerical duties such as maintaining supplies, tracking use of company's sporting event tickets, updating directories, placing gift orders for VIP clients, faxing, copying, and filing
• Perform other duties related to supporting Executives as requested
• Assist Executives with preparation for meetings
• Attend certain meetings and records, transcribes, and distributes meeting minutes within appropriate time frames
• Assist Executives with following up on action items from meetings
• Prepare various sales and business reports from database system
Skills and Requirements
• College degree preferred but will accept someone with equivalent work experience.
• Proficiency in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Lotus Notes.
• Excellent organizational, meeting planning coordination and project management skills.
• Organized, independent, and self-motivated with a team player attitude.
